alpha-to-coverage must be applied before alpha-to-one. The only way to do
that is to export alpha for alpha-to-coverage via mrtz, and export 1 via
mrt0.a.
ACO and monolithic shader support is already in place thanks to RADV,
so we only need to change the LLVM PS epilog and the shader key.

Cross-invocation TCS input access doesn't prevent same-invocation access.
This improves shaders that use both for the same inputs.
Also, if some components of a vec4 slot only use same-invocation access and
other components only use cross-invocation access (it's possible after
compaction), this takes the VGPR path for the components with
same-invocation access, which didn't happen previously because all masks
only describe whole vec4s.
